Some people would say, however, that the whole subject of buying and selling property makes them feel rather nervous. Such feelings may well stem from the fact that there's a large financial investment involved and that there are plenty of horror stories about how things can go wrong.

It may be useful to try and keep the situation in some sort of perspective. The reality is that the vast majority of moves end up going according to plan. I'm not suggesting that you won't encounter minor problems, but such issues are to be expected, given the scale of the changes that you are making.

If every house move was a disaster, then absolutely nobody would end up relocating. The fact that many people are, in fact, happy to do so does point to the fact that there's not too much to worry about. If you are worried about the entire process, then it may certainly help if you can learn more.

One way of doing this is to make use of the Internet as a research tool. The fact that so many people move home each year means that there are plenty of individuals who are able to offer stories and advice. There are also reputable websites that will explain the whole process.

You do need to understand, of course, that the exact nature of the process will vary considerably from one location to the next. Make sure that you read information that is relevant to your own, personal circumstances. You'll find that having this knowledge may well help to ease your mind and make the whole process less stressful.

It also helps if you're able to hire trusted experts. You'll undoubtedly need some sort of legal expertise and you may also wish to hire a surveyor. Take the time to talk to the professionals and you'll discover a lot of information.

Once you start to gain confidence, you'll find that the thought of moving home becomes a lot less worrying.
